Resolution against the Thomas Un-American Activities Committee, 1947-12-12

The letter is from the Citizens' Committee for Better Education to Honorable Helen Gahagan Douglas, expressing concern about the infringement of constitutional rights during recent hearings conducted by the Thomas Un-American Activities Committee. The committee is urging representatives in Congress to condemn the actions of the committee and support its abolishment. The letter includes information about a bill related to investigating committees and a statement made on the House floor regarding contempt citations.
